Introduction: The Importance of Website Accessibility

In today's digital landscape, having a website that caters to all users is no longer optional; it is a fundamental requirement. Accessibility ensures that individuals with disabilities—be it visual, auditory, motor, or cognitive—can navigate, understand, and engage with your digital content effortlessly. Yet, many websites still fall short of compliance standards like W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ines), risking legal repercussions and losing potential customers.

Implementing AI-Driven Accessibility Analysis: Tools and Strategies

Integrating AI into your accessibility efforts involves selecting the right tools and establishing best practices. Here are some effective approaches:

  2. Combine AI with Manual Testing: While AI accelerates detection, human oversight remains vital. Combine automated insights with manual user testing, especially for complex interaction scenarios.
  3. Continuous Integration: Embed AI accessibility checks into your CI/CD (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ment) pipelines to catch issues early and prevent non-compliant updates from going live.
